We review some of the present ideas on chemical evolution of irregular galaxies and disks of spiral galaxies. Based on the O abundances in stars and H II regions we present a discussion of the yield; we also discuss the effects of large scale mass flows and of cold dark matter to explain variations in the observed yield.
